Converter processes.
Continuous gas-mixture composition analysis of converter gases at the gas-output tract and
at the fire-tube, of oxygen-blast and of gas in argon-blast mode provides the lowering of
workshops power consumption and explosion characteristics of gas-tubes and make the
efficiency and produced steel quality higher.
The installation of such complexes turns to be economically reasonable because of:
- possibility of full-combustion melting;
- reducing of re-blasts and double blasts;
- shortening of average time of melting process within one shift;
- steel quality improvement;
- reducing of blast oxygen and other technological materials (lime, cocks) usage.
EMG-21 gas-analyzer ensures exact determination of CO and CO2 up to 0,05%. This provides
forecasting of steel production by carbon with the accuracy of 0,01% for lowly alloyed
steels and with the accuracy of 0,05% for middle alloyed steels.
The scheme of gas-analyzing complex for converter processes
The data measured and processed by gas-analyzing complex provides the following possibilities for the operator at the converter control station:
- To determine the exact moment of meting "combustion".
- To determine the exact moment of blast-finish by CO falling-down curve.
- To control the level of lime assimilation.
- To control the hermetic characteristics of gas-output tract in accordance with the O2 chart.

Blast-furnace processes.
The use of gas-analysis in blast-furnace processes helps in resolving tasks of emergency
situations reduction, technological modes control and optimal technological parameters
adjustment. Such improvements provide reduction of blast oxygen, natural gas and coke
consumption rates, makes labor efficiency and quality of produced pig iron higher.
EMG-21 gas-analyzing complex ensures operative gas-composition control all along
the blast-furnace radius in real time taking gas samples with the use of movable sondes.
The data on blast-furnace top gas serves for:
- process uniformity control in ore melting
- reducing medium control in blast furnace mouth
- caloric value of blast-furnace top gas and natural gas determination

Autogeneric processes
Continuous gas-analysis on-line ensures unit's heat balance maintenance in operating mode,
autogeneric melting mode control, accident prevention and industrial safety increase.
The scheme of gas-analyzing complex at the fixture of autogeneric melting
Implementation of gas-analyzing complex at autogeneric melting unit provides:
- burner / melting mode control in accordance with percent composition of SO2, CO2, O2
- oxidizing melting of concentrate and slag output preparation mode (reducing mode) control
- waste gases SO2 concentration control for sulphuric acid production

Oil chemistry industry
The use of gas-analysis in petroleum industry provides:
-
hydric reducing gas composition and waste gases control for processing units
in catalytic oil processing (reforming, cracking etc.); technological process
optimization and high quality of products produced
-
inert gas and air input regulation during catalyst regeneration process needed
for quality improvement of expensive catalyst reduction
-
oxygen complete combustion and CO2 (destroys catalyst) absence control in inert gas production

During 2000 METTEK in co-operation with the Department of Oil- and Coal-chemistry
Technologies of St-Petersburg Technological Institute was making estimations of gaseous
phase of different units at NZP "KINEF" plant (Kirishi, Leningradskaya obl.).
Estimations, analyzing of the results and control measurements performed have
shown the practicability of EMG-21 implementation, especially for technological
processes optimization at the following units:
-
at the electric demineralizing plant using atmospheric and vacuum pipe-steel -
to perform express analysis of low-boiling fractions composition and to perform
percent fraction composition estimation and product purification control
-
at 62-105C, 105-127C, 85-180C low-boiling fractions catalytic reforming units -
to perform feedstock express analysis and control, to perform catalytic reforming
and final product purification control
-
at 135-240C fraction hydro fining units - to perform express composition analysis
and quality control of hydrogen input, to perform H2C, NH3, H2O output and fraction
desulphatesation control
-
at 190-360C fraction hydro fining units - to perform hydro fining control
-
at catalytic reforming units during catalyst regeneration - to perform regenerative mixture express analysis,
to perform CO2 content and gas mixture control at the technological line
Sequential automatic scan of different gas-sampling points and possibility of simultaneous
analysis of different technological gases resulted in high efficiency of EMG-21
mass-spectral complex utilization for running and control of technological processes.
The complex performs both organic and inorganic compounds analysis for one and the same
gas mixture.
